A corporate headshot day — bringing a photographer to your office to photograph your whole team in a single session — is significantly more efficient and cost-effective than sending individuals to separate appointments. Running one successfully requires coordination, realistic scheduling, and clear communication internally. This guide covers everything you need to organise it well.
The most common mistake in organising a headshot day is underestimating the time. A standard individual headshot appointment is 15–20 minutes. Building a schedule:
| Team size | Total session time |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| 5–10 people | 2–3 hours | Add 30 min setup and 15 min buffer for late arrivals |
| 10–20 people | 3.5–5 hours | Consider a lunch break in the middle |
| 20–40 people | 5–8 hours (full day) | Can be split across two separate days if needed |
| 40+ people | Multiple days | Consider scheduling across departments on successive days |

If no suitable indoor space exists, many photographers can work outside — a building entrance with clean architecture, a courtyard, or a nearby park can all produce excellent corporate headshots with the right approach.
The biggest single decision is whether you want a plain studio-style background, an environmental/contextual background (office interior, architectural elements), or a blurred natural environment. This preference should be agreed before the session day and communicated to both the photographer and the team so everyone arrives with consistent expectations.

Clarify the delivery format at booking. Individual galleries require more management but give employees agency over their image. A curated single selection per person is simpler to administer. Agree this process before the session day.
Pricing varies significantly based on team size, photographer experience, session length, and deliverables. For smaller teams (up to 20 people), expect to pay £500–£1,500 as a day rate with a set number of edited images per person included. For larger teams, per-head rates are more common. Always obtain a detailed quote specifying what is included.
Technically yes, but it undermines the visual consistency that makes a set of team headshots valuable. Agree on one approach and apply it consistently. If senior leadership needs a distinct style, separate them from the main company shoot rather than mixing mid-session.
Schedule the headshot day to coincide with a planned all-hands day or a meeting that already brings remote employees in. Alternatively, book the photographer for a second partial day to cover those not present. Using a different photographer for remote team members creates the style inconsistency you are trying to avoid.
For senior leadership or external-facing executives, professional hair and make-up is worth considering — it significantly reduces editing work and produces a more polished result. For a full company headshot day, it is rare and impractical. Good grooming advice sent in advance is sufficient.
